n8n工作流:一键搞定7个平台的选题、配图、发布全流程

2025-11-21 16:03:27
文章摘要
原本要在 7 个平台来回改文案、换图、填标签、等领导审批、最后再到处登录发布的繁琐流程,现在可以被压缩成 3 分钟。整套方案用 n8n+国产模型搭建,让新媒体运营从苦力活变成“自动流水线”。

在国内,企业做新媒体运营往往要同时维护微信公众号、小红书、抖音、视频号、微博、知乎、B站等多个平台。

每个平台的内容风格、字数限制、话题标签都不一样,运营人员每天要做的事情包括:

 反复改写同一条内容,同一个产品发布,要分别改成抖音短视频文案、小红书种草笔记、微信公众号长文。

 手动配图、加标签,每个平台要单独上传图片、手动输入话题标签,一个内容发 7 个平台要重复操作 7 次。

 审批流程卡顿,内容写好了要给领导审.领导不在就卡住,错过热点黄金时间。

 数据分散难复盘,各平台发布结果散落在不同后台,没法统一看效果。

这套方案就是为了解决这些问题,用 工作流一键生成适配 7 个平台的内容,自动配图,邮件审批通过后一键发布,全程只需要 3 分钟。


一、方案逻辑(n8n + 国产模型)

整个流程分为 4 大步骤

步骤 1 填写表单,触发工作流

  1. 在一个网页表单里填写:
  2. 主题(如公司新品发布会)
  3. 关键词(比如AI、科技、创新)
  4. 链接(可选,如产品详情页)


步骤 2 AI 自动生成 7 个平台的内容

n8n 调用 魔塔社区 API(或本地大模型)生成

  1. 微博:140 字短文案 + 3 个话题标签
  2. 小红书:种草笔记(300 字)+ 封面图建议 + emoji
  3. 抖音/视频号:15 秒短视频脚本 + 热门 BGM 推荐
  4. 微信公众号:800 字深度解读 + 引导关注话术
  5. B站:视频标题 + 简介 + 分区标签
  6. 知乎:问答式长文(1000 字)+ SEO 关键词
  7. 企业微信:内部通知版本

关键技术点

使用 结构化输出(JSON Schema),让 AI 按固定格式返回内容,确保每个平台的字段都能自动填充。

通过 魔塔 API搜索功能 自动查找行业热点,让内容更有时效性。


步骤 3 自动生成配图

两种方式二选一

1. AI 生图:调用 魔塔社区的文生图模型(如 Stable Diffusion),根据内容描述自动生成配图。

2. 手动上传:你也可以在表单里直接上传图片,工作流会自动压缩并上传到 阿里云 OSS 或 腾讯云 COS,生成可外链的图片地址。

注意:AI 生成的图片可能不符合品牌调性,图片尺寸要提前设置好,小红书是 3:4,抖音是 9:16,微博是 16:9。


步骤 4 邮件审批 + 一键发布

n8n 会自动生成一封 HTML 格式的审批邮件,包含

 所有平台的内容预览(直接看效果)

 批准发布和驳回修改两个选项

领导点击批准后,工作流自动调用各平台 API 发布:

 微博:通过微博开放平台 API 发布

 小红书:通过小红书创作者平台 API 发布

 抖音/视频号:通过字节跳动开放平台/微信视频号 API 发布

 企业微信:通过企业微信群机器人推送


二、实操流程

第 1 步 准备 API 密钥

你需要注册以下服务并获取 API 密钥

服务

用途

注册地址

魔塔社区

AI生成内容

modelscope.cn

阿里云OSS

图片存储

aliyun.com

微博开放平台

发布微博

open.weibo.com

小红书开放平台

发布笔记

open.xiaohongshu.com

企业微信

发送审批邮件

work.weixin.qq.com


微博/小红书 API 需要企业认证,个人用户无法调用。


第 2 步:导入 n8n 工作流模板

1. 下载本文提供的 JSON 文件(文末附下载链接)。

2. 打开 n8n,点击右上角导入工作流。

3. 上传 JSON 文件,模板会自动加载所有节点。

 多平台工作流.json (68 KB)


第 3 步:配置AI 内容生成节点

找到名为 "Social Media Content Factory" 的节点,这是核心的 AI 生成模块。

关键参数配置

 模型选择:改为 魔塔社区/通义千问-Max(原模板用的是 GPT-4)

 提示词模板:保持默认即可,它会根据你填的主题自动生成内容

 输出格式:保持 JSON Schema 不变,这是让 AI 返回结构化数据的关键

提示:如果生成的内容太短,可以在提示词里加一句每个平台的内容不少于 200 字。


第 4 步:配置图片生成节点

找到名为 "OpenAI" 的节点(我们要改成魔塔AI)。

修改步骤:

1. 删除原有的 OpenAI 节点。

2. 新增一个 "HTTP Request" 节点。

3. 配置如下: URL:https://api.modelscope.cn/v1/images/generations

Method:POST

请求体:

{
       "model": "stabilityai/stable-diffusion-xl",
       "prompt": "{{AI 生成的图片描述}}",
       "size": "1024x1024"
     }


Headers:添加 Authorization: Bearer 你的魔塔 API 密钥

生成的图片会返回一个临时链接,我们要把它上传到阿里云 OSS 永久保存:

1. 新增一个 "阿里云 OSS 上传" 节点。

2. 填写 Bucket 名称、AccessKey、SecretKey。

3. 将图片 URL 传给后续的发布节点。


第 5 步 配置邮件审批

找到名为 "Gmail User for Approval" 的节,登录你的Gmail账号。

填写:

收件人:你的审批人邮箱

邮件标题:待审批】{{主题}}内容预览

邮件内容:使用 HTML 模板(模板已自动生成,包含所有平台的内容卡片)


第 6 步 配置各平台发布节点

这是最复杂的部分,因为每个平台的 API 都不一样。以 微博 和 小红书 为例

微博发布节点

1. 新增 "HTTP Request" 节点。

2. 配置:URL:https://api.weibo.com/2/statuses/share.json

Method:POST

请求体:

{
       "access_token": "你的微博 access_token",
       "status": "{{AI 生成的微博文案}}",
       "pic": "{{OSS 图片链接}}"
     }

注意:微博 access_token 有效期只有 7 天,需要定期刷新,小红书对笔记内容有敏感词检测。


第 7 步 配置结果通知

所有平台发布完成后,工作流会自动生成一份结果报告,通过 企业微信 或 钉钉 发送给你。

报告内容包括:哪些平台发布成功,哪些平台失败和错误原因,各平台的内容链接。


总结

这套方案的核心价值是,用 AI替代重复劳动,如果你是企业新媒体负责人,这套方案能让你的团队效率提升 5 倍。

附:资源下载

n8n 工作流 JSON 文件

 多平台工作流.json (68 KB)


声明:该内容由作者自行发布,观点内容仅供参考,不代表平台立场;如有侵权,请联系平台删除。